After placings in two of her first four starts, the Bjorn Baker-trained filly Allez Bien did well to score her first win in a four-way finish. She worked from barrier seven to find the lead and then eased to race in third place on the rails. She went back to the inner at the 100m and then battled gamely to win in a photo. The Chris Waller-trained filly Canberra raced in sixth place, one off the rails, moved up (under riding) nearing the home turn, challenged at the 100m and then fought on well for a close second while My Kind worked to find the lead in the mid-stages and held on well for a close-up third. Another Chris Waller runner Arazona was near last at the home turn and made very good late ground for a close-up fourth at his second run this preparation.
